Why is Xanax prescribed more often (or at least mentioned more often) than Buspar? |
|
Edited on Wed Apr-02-08 12:43 PM by hedgehog
There is a high risk of abuse with Xanax. As far as I know, there is very little risk of abuse with Buspar.

Buspar is a drug you must take everyday, whether having anxiety issues or not. With Xanax, you take it as needed. I took Buspar before and promptly put on 20 pounds.
